Construction only begins in the 2040s

why are science projects so slow? can we do anything to speed them up? maybe increase investments?

[-] themeatbridge@lemmy.world 10 points 8 months ago

Planning. You have to write down every detail, and it takes time and costs money. Someone has to figure out how to manufacture ever part, estimate how many labor hours it will take, select paint colors and door handles and a billion other small things. It will require teams of people coordinating efforts around the globe and getting feedback from every stakeholder imaginable.
